
C语言Eclipse如何配置
安装Eclipse、安装CDT插件、配置编译器、配置调试环境、创建新项目
在本文开头,直接回答标题所提问题。配置C语言环境的Eclipse主要涉及五个步骤:安装Eclipse、安装CDT插件、配置编译器、配置调试环境、创建新项目。其中,安装CDT插件是整个过程的核心,因为它提供了Eclipse进行C/C++开发的必要工具和环境。
安装CDT插件的具体步骤如下:首先,启动Eclipse,选择“Help”菜单下的“Eclipse Marketplace”,然后搜索“C/C++ Development Tools (CDT)”,点击“Install”按钮,按照提示完成安装。安装完成后,重启Eclipse,即可在新建项目中看到C/C++的选项。
接下来,我们将详细介绍每个步骤。
一、安装Eclipse
1. 下载Eclipse
首先,访问Eclipse官方网站(https://www.eclipse.org/),在下载页面选择“Eclipse IDE for C/C++ Developers”。这个版本已经包含了CDT插件,省去了后续安装插件的步骤。
2. 安装Eclipse
下载完成后,解压缩文件包,然后运行“eclipse.exe”文件。首次启动时,Eclipse会询问工作空间的位置,工作空间是用于存放项目文件的目录,选择一个合适的位置后点击“Launch”按钮即可。
二、安装CDT插件
1. 启动Eclipse Marketplace
如果你下载的是标准版Eclipse或其他版本,则需要手动安装CDT插件。在Eclipse中,点击顶部菜单栏的“Help”,然后选择“Eclipse Marketplace”。
2. 搜索并安装CDT插件
在Eclipse Marketplace中,搜索“C/C++ Development Tools (CDT)”,找到后点击“Install”按钮,按照提示完成安装。安装过程中可能会提示需要接受许可协议,勾选同意并继续。安装完成后,重启Eclipse。
三、配置编译器
1. 安装GCC编译器
在Windows系统中,推荐使用MinGW或Cygwin作为GCC编译器。在MinGW官方网站(http://www.mingw.org/)下载最新版本的安装程序,运行安装程序并选择需要的组件,特别是“gcc-core”和“g++”。安装完成后,将MinGW的“bin”目录添加到系统的环境变量中。
2. 配置Eclipse使用GCC编译器
启动Eclipse,进入“Window”菜单,选择“Preferences”,在左侧树状菜单中展开“C/C++”,选择“Build”下的“Environment”,点击“Add”按钮,添加以下环境变量:
- Name: PATH
- Value: <MinGW安装目录>bin
完成后,点击“OK”保存。
四、配置调试环境
1. 安装GDB调试器
大多数GCC安装包中已经包含了GDB调试器。如果没有包含,可以在MinGW安装程序中选择安装“gdb”组件。
2. 配置Eclipse使用GDB调试器
在Eclipse中,进入“Window”菜单,选择“Preferences”,在左侧树状菜单中展开“C/C++”,选择“Debug”下的“GDB”,确保“GDB Debugger”路径正确指向GDB可执行文件。
五、创建新项目
1. 创建C项目
在Eclipse中,点击“File”菜单,选择“New”下的“C Project”。在弹出的对话框中,输入项目名称,选择项目类型为“Hello World ANSI C Project”,点击“Next”按钮。
2. 配置项目设置
在“Project Settings”页面,选择工具链为“MinGW GCC”,然后点击“Finish”完成项目创建。Eclipse会自动生成一个Hello World程序和必要的项目文件。
六、编写和运行程序
1. 编写代码
在项目资源管理器中,展开项目目录,找到“src”文件夹中的“hello.c”文件,双击打开。在编辑器中,可以修改或编写自己的C代码。
2. 编译和运行
在顶部菜单栏中,点击“Project”菜单,选择“Build All”进行编译。如果编译成功,可以在控制台中看到编译输出的消息。接着,点击“Run”菜单,选择“Run As”下的“Local C/C++ Application”,Eclipse会自动运行生成的可执行文件,并在控制台中显示输出结果。
七、调试程序
1. 设置断点
在代码编辑器中,找到需要调试的代码行,双击左侧的灰色边栏,添加一个断点。添加断点后,边栏会显示一个小蓝色圆点。
2. 启动调试
在顶部菜单栏中,点击“Run”菜单,选择“Debug As”下的“Local C/C++ Application”。Eclipse会启动调试模式,并在断点处暂停执行。
3. 调试控制
在调试视图中,可以使用工具栏上的按钮来控制程序的执行,例如“Step Over”、“Step Into”、“Resume”等。调试过程中,可以查看变量的值,观察程序的执行流程。
八、项目管理工具推荐
在项目管理过程中,推荐使用以下两个工具:
-
研发项目管理系统PingCode:PingCode是一款专为研发团队设计的项目管理工具,支持需求管理、缺陷跟踪、任务管理等功能,帮助团队高效协作,提高研发效率。
-
通用项目管理软件Worktile:Worktile是一款通用的项目管理软件,适用于各类团队的项目管理需求,提供任务管理、时间管理、文档管理等功能,帮助团队更好地组织和管理工作。
九、总结
通过以上步骤,我们完成了在Eclipse中配置C语言开发环境的全部过程。从安装Eclipse和CDT插件,到配置编译器和调试器,再到创建和运行项目,每一步都至关重要。安装CDT插件是整个过程的核心,确保我们能够在Eclipse中进行C/C++开发。希望本文能够帮助您顺利配置C语言环境的Eclipse,并提高您的开发效率。
相关问答FAQs:
1. 如何在Eclipse中配置C语言开发环境?
在Eclipse中配置C语言开发环境需要进行以下步骤:
- 首先,确保已经安装了C/C++开发工具链,例如MinGW或者Cygwin。
- 打开Eclipse,并选择菜单栏中的"Window" -> "Preferences"。
- 在"Preferences"对话框中,选择"C/C++" -> "Build" -> "Environment"。
- 点击"Add"按钮,添加C/C++编译器路径到环境变量中。
- 确认配置并点击"Apply"按钮,然后关闭对话框。
- 现在,您可以创建一个新的C语言项目并开始编写代码了。
2. 如何在Eclipse中创建一个新的C语言项目?
在Eclipse中创建一个新的C语言项目需要按照以下步骤进行:
- 首先,打开Eclipse并选择菜单栏中的"File" -> "New" -> "C Project"。
- 在弹出的对话框中,输入项目名称和选择C语言项目模板。
- 点击"Next"按钮并选择编译器,例如MinGW或者Cygwin。
- 确认配置并点击"Finish"按钮,Eclipse将会创建一个新的C语言项目。
- 现在,您可以在项目中创建C源文件并开始编写代码了。
3. 如何在Eclipse中调试C语言程序?
在Eclipse中调试C语言程序需要按照以下步骤进行:
- 首先,确保在编译时添加了调试信息(例如使用-g选项)。
- 在Eclipse中打开要调试的C语言项目。
- 找到要调试的源文件,并在源文件中设置断点。
- 在菜单栏中选择"Run" -> "Debug Configurations"。
- 在"Debug Configurations"对话框中,选择"C/C++ Application"并点击"New"按钮。
- 在"Main"选项卡中,选择要调试的C程序的可执行文件。
- 确认配置并点击"Debug"按钮,Eclipse将会启动调试器并在断点处停止。
- 现在,您可以使用调试器的功能来单步执行代码、查看变量的值等。
- 调试完成后,可以点击"Terminate"按钮来停止调试。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/1166426